A Rainbow of Deadly Creatures

The most striking feature of this add-on is the introduction of new color variations for dragons, sea serpents, sirens, and ogres. In the base mod, creature colors often correlated strictly with their element or biome. However, Ice and Fire Travail decouples some of these restrictions and adds entirely new palettes. You might now encounter a sapphire-blue fire dragon soaring over a savanna or an emerald-green ice dragon lurking in a frozen peak. These are not just cosmetic changes; they signal different spawning rarities and behaviors that keep veteran players on their toes.

Sea serpents have received particular attention in this update. Their spawn logic now accounts for ocean depth, meaning the deeper you dive, the more likely you are to encounter rare and vividly colored variants. This adds a compelling reason to explore the darkest trenches of your Minecraft oceans, armed with the new armor sets designed specifically to counter these colorful threats. Speaking of gear, the add-on includes craftable armors tailored to the new dragon and sea serpent colors, ensuring that your equipment matches the prestige of your hunt.

Enhanced Loot and World Generation

Beyond the visual spectacle, the gameplay loop gets a meaningful upgrade through improved drop tables and world generation tweaks. Sirens now drop extra basic items, making encounters with them more rewarding for those brave enough to face their songs. Furthermore, the rock generation logic has been refined. When exploring caves or mining near dragon roosts, you may now find additional ores, unique blocks, and special drop items embedded within the stone formations. These minor changes accumulate to create a richer economy and more diverse inventory for survivalists.

Installation and Compatibility

Getting started with this thrilling content is straightforward for those familiar with modding. The Ice and Fire Travail add-on is designed to work seamlessly with modern versions of Minecraft, typically supporting releases from 1.12.2 up to newer iterations depending on the specific build you choose. It requires the appropriate loader, such as Forge or Fabric, to function correctly. Always check the specific version requirements listed on the distribution page before attempting to launch your game to prevent crashes.

If you are wondering how to install this modification, the process mirrors standard mod procedures. First, ensure your loader is installed. Next, locate your Minecraft mods folder. Finally, place the downloaded jar file inside that directory. Once you download Ice and Fire Travail and move it to the correct folder, launch the game and generate a new world to see the new colors in action. Remember that this is a derivative library based on the earlier 1.8.4 version of the original mod, operating under the LGPLv3 license, which permits such creative expansions.
